GONZALEZ GARCIA, Emma Esther  y  CASTILLO MONTOYA, Rolando. Vascular approach for hemodialysis in patients with chronic renal disease. MEDISAN [online]. 2009, vol.13, n.3. ISSN 1029-3019.

The current situation of the vascular approach for hemodialysis was valued by means of a longitudinal and cross-sectional study of active patients that started their treatment from the creation of the Department of Hemodyalisis in "Dr. Juan Bruno Zayas" General Teaching Hospital of Santiago de Cuba from 1996 to September, 2008. Neccesary data (cause of renal disease, sex, age, type of vascular approach, time in dialysis, previous attempt at arteriovenous fistula and others) were obtained from automated medical records, physical examination and evaluation of the vascular approach. The latter was performed specially through an autogenous arteriovenous fistula located in the elbow anterior flexure; a procedure that had been attempted 2 or more times in 21 patients of the total and it had failed by deficiency of the vessel state and thrombosis of these fistulae. The occurrence of aneurysms was the most frequent complication attributable to the little rotation in the punction site.
